Hitachi forays into smaller cities with KAZE launch
3/13/2010 12:04:31 AM
EARLY TIMES REPORT
JAMMU, Mar 12: Hitachi Home & Life Solutions (India) Ltd (HHLI), a subsidiary of Hitachi Appliance Inc, Japan, today launched its new range of air-conditioners "KAZE" designed especially for the India market.
KAZE brings Hitachi's unparalleled blend of superior technology, elegant design and high energy efficiency to a wider market in Tier 2 & 3 towns through its competitive pricing.
The new BEE star rated, KAZE range, comprising of 4 variants, is differentiated on account of the unique Kaimin technology in addition to other comfort features that have been incorporated in this range.
"Based on the introduction of KAZE and an aggressive pricing strategy, we expect to notch up 50,000 units of KAZE in our AC Volumes this year", stated Rajesh Nagari, General Manager, North at Hitachi Home & Life Solutions (India) Ltd.
The Intelligent Auto Humid Control feature helps you to achieve comfortable room ambient even during high humid conditions.
The revolutionary Kaimin technology adjusts the temperature automatically through the night to suit your body needs and ensure you get sound sleep and wake up fresh every morning.
"The key thrust area as far as our home appliance range is concerned, has been on enhancing the energy efficiency of the product range and blending the superior designs with unparallel performance.", added Nagari.
The KAZE would be available in four variants 0.9 Tr., 1.2 Tr., 1.5 Tr. & 2.0 Tr. priced at Rs 24,990, Rs 27,990, Rs 29,990 and Rs 33,990 respectively.
The company established 25 years ago after successfully establishing its base in metros & other major markets with high quality premium Air conditioners is now set to focus in smaller markets with latest offering. "The financial year 2009-10 has been very remarkable for us.
We are currently growing at fast pace. Going forward we have set our targets to cross the two lacs figure mark in the next financial year", said Nagari
